I have a 1150 adv and before it was run in I ditched the cat and put in a K&N filter.
She seems to lunge when de accelerating and she backfires like a good 'un.
The first thing I did was to reseal the exhaust as I assumed there was an airleak. I used a jointing compound but she still did it.
Ok next did the valves and balanced the throttle bodies, so that side is sorted.
Went to try the "Steptoe" fix, here is where I need the advice.
I measured the voltage on the TPS before I started messing, reading .381 volts. reset the motronic, .380. Ok so far all reset.
Put on the jumper fix and reset motronic. Measured the voltage .377!!!! to me that will make the mixture leaner and make the surging worse? BMW recommend .370-.400 and on one American site they say you can go to .450, but it will bugger up the cat (don't have one so don't care)
Question does the jumper reset the TPS? if so by resetting the TPS you are bypassing the jumper?
